Endocrine Disruptors: Phthalates

Phthalates and Cosmetics
Realizing that some chemicals present within certain commonly used plastics acted as weak oestrogen mimics, a group of scientists decided to investigate the situation further. After some in depth research into possible candidates, the team finally settled on one family of chemicals; the phthalates.

The Ubiquity of Phthalates

Two members of the phthalate family were found to be particularly estrogenic, these were butylbenzyl phthalate (BBP) and dibutyl phthalate (DBP).

But the problem is that phthalates like bisphenol A are everywhere. They constituted one of the largest groups of industrial chemicals and are widely used in all plastics. Why phthalates are popular in industry is because they are the chemicals that gave plastics their flexibility. They are used in nearly all forms of everyday plastic materials. BBP are often used in the production of vinyl floor tiles and adhesives whereas DBP are often used as a plasticizer in food packaging materials like polyvinyl chloride. But most worryingly phthalates are added to certain kinds of cosmetics to give them a smoother feel.
